[Manchester Orchestra – “My Backwards Walk”](
This one still hurts. Scottish band Frightened Rabbits were in the process of celebrating the 10th anniversary of their break out album The Midnight Organ Fight when lead singer Scott Hutchison took his life. His legacy includes some truly powerful songs, many of which are included on the finally realized TINY CHANGES: A CELEBRATION OF THE MIDNIGHT ORGAN FIGHT. This album, which replicated the original with versions recorded by friends of the band, is so very bittersweet. Manchester Orchestra deliver a brilliant version of “My Backwards Walk” and in doing so provide an idea of what you can expect from this project.

Just five colors. (BR Core Temp has ten.) Some of which could be tough to pull off in some workplaces.Â
Made from 64% cotton, 33% polyester, and 3% spandex/elasthane, these pants look and feel much more like traditional chinos than [a pure-poly option at Old Navy](. But here’s the million dollar (or, fifty – sixty dollar, depending on sales) question: Are they as good as [the BR Core Temp Chinos](? I canât go that far. But theyâre approximately $10 cheaper when both are on sale for 40% off, and it seems like the EXPRESS option might go on sale more often. Banana Republic’s Core Temp? Almost always (but not always) excluded from their promotions. And these EXPRESS alternatives are still quite versatile. In fact, I would venture to say that many would prefer these to the core temps when taking price into consideration.
[In Review: The EXPRESS 365 Comfort Stretch+ Chino | Dappered.com](//www.express.com/clothing/men/slim-365-comfort-stretch-chino/pro/03083139/color/Chalk/?AID=11553913&PID=4025845&CID=550&pubname=Dappered&pubID=4025845&SID=&CJEVENT=1e6e962babf811e9805601b60a1c0e13)
Size 36W x 32L on 5â11, 195lbs. Color is “Cobblestone.”
What jumps out to me is the look and the feel. These arenât shiny. Thereâs no âswish swishâ when you walk. To the naked eye, they are regular chinos (slanted front pockets and back pockets that fasten close). And yet, they offer plenty of stretch. Theyâre slim, but not too slim (those of us on Team Leg Day may rejoice!), look great with a casual-leaning blazer, or no jacket and just a polo, button down, or [back-in-style print shirt from somewhere like Bonobos](. And in terms of size, I recommend either ordering your normal size in chinos or going slightly down. (I normally take 34 or 35 ⦠35 isnât available, and post-honeymoon, I was worried 34 would be too small. The 36 was good but I would definitely tailor to make smaller).
[In Review: The EXPRESS 365 Comfort Stretch+ Chino | Dappered.com](//www.express.com/clothing/men/slim-365-comfort-stretch-chino/pro/03083139/color/Chalk/?AID=11553913&PID=4025845&CID=550&pubname=Dappered&pubID=4025845&SID=&CJEVENT=1e6e962babf811e9805601b60a1c0e13)
The chambray accent around the waist. Easily hidden by belt if you don’t like it.
Despite this praise, these pants have two notable flaws: the odd stripe at the belt-line and the color options. The stripe most likely wonât matter to you. When I saw it on the site, I thought the model was just wearing a really slim belt. When they arrived, I thought the stripe was an odd addition, but one that would never be seen because I always wear a belt (apologies to the suspenders community). Can you wear the majority of color options at work? I sure canât. So 60% of the options would never make it to my office. And the âcobblestoneâ pants I received looked browner on the website and greyer in real life. I much prefer grey pants to brown, but I was definitely surprised and wonder if the other colors look different in real life too.
Overall, these pants are a welcome addition to the tech pants community. Slightly cheaper than the reigning champ, Express offers a versatile option I fully recommend.
